13-year-old from St Agnes establishes dairy business with single cow

A 13-year-old boy in St Agnes has started a dairy business, Sid's Dairy, selling milk and cream produced by his Jersey cow, Clare.

A 13-year-old boy from St Agnes has established a dairy business, Sid's Dairy, using a single cow to produce milk and cream. Charlie sells the products directly to customers.

Charlie, who grew up around animals, milks his Jersey cow, Clare, daily after school using a portable milking machine. He reportedly bought Clare as a calf with money he had saved for two years.

He stated that if his products continue to sell out daily, he would consider acquiring another cow to increase milk production. Charlie also pays for Clare's food and a portion of her veterinary expenses.
